Are Welspun Specialty Solutions Ltd latest results good or bad?

Welspun Specialty Solutions Ltd's latest results show mixed performance, with a year-on-year sales increase of 9.79% but a quarterly decline of 2.79%. The company reported a net loss for FY25, indicating profitability challenges, although there are signs of operational recovery and improved financial stability.
Welspun Specialty Solutions Ltd's latest financial results present a complex picture of its performance. In Q4 FY26, the company reported net sales of ₹219.75 crores, reflecting a year-on-year increase of 9.79%, although this was accompanied by a sequential decline of 2.79% from the previous quarter. This indicates a mixed demand environment, with the year-on-year growth suggesting some resilience, while the quarter-on-quarter decrease raises concerns about recent momentum.
The operating margin for the latest quarter was reported at 0.0%, with no complete profitability data available for a comprehensive analysis. However, the average return on equity (ROE) of 18.85% suggests a reasonable level of capital efficiency, despite the challenges faced in profitability. For the full fiscal year FY25, Welspun Specialty Solutions experienced a net loss of ₹4.00 crores, a significant decline from the profit of ₹62.00 crores in FY24. This shift was attributed to various factors, including a contraction in operating profit and increased interest costs, which rose to ₹43.00 crores from ₹33.00 crores in the prior year. The operating margin also compressed to 4.1% from 7.9%, indicating potential pricing pressures and cost challenges. On a more positive note, the nine-month period ending December 2025 showed a revenue growth of 21.95%, suggesting improved operational momentum prior to the recent quarterly slowdown. The company has also undertaken a significant balance sheet restructuring, with shareholder funds increasing substantially and long-term debt declining, indicating a shift towards a more stable financial position. In the most recent quarter ending June 2026, net sales further declined by 11.87% compared to the previous quarter, while standalone net profit showed an increase of 21.13%. The operating profit margin improved slightly to 5.44%, indicating some operational recovery despite the drop in sales. Overall, the company saw an adjustment in its evaluation, reflecting the ongoing challenges in profitability and revenue growth amidst a backdrop of structural changes and market dynamics. The financial performance highlights the need for Welspun Specialty Solutions to navigate its operational hurdles while capitalizing on any emerging opportunities in the specialty steel market.
